a sedimentary rock containing a fossilized sea shell had been found. what does this tell you about the area at the time the rock was formed?

Sedimentary rocks are formed from the breaking apart of other rocks (igneous, metamorphic, or sedimentary rocks) and the cementation, compaction and recrystallization of these broken pieces of rock.

It tells you that there used to be an ocean in the area the rock was found.
